Recent reports from the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ine indicate that the previous day saw 237 combat engagements across various fronts, with significant activity concentrated in the Huliaipole and Pokrovsk directions.
In the Pokrovsk area, Ukrainian forces successfully repelled 42 assault attempts by Russian troops near several settlements, including Zatyshok, Rodynske, and Shchevchenko, among others. Meanwhile, the Huliaipole front experienced 49 attacks, particularly around Huliaipole and extending towards Dobropillia and other nearby locations.
Additionally, 22 Russian assaults were recorded in the Kostiantynivka direction. Combat operations also occurred in the Northern Slobozhansky, Southern Slobozhansky, Kupiansk, Lyman, Sloviansk, Kramatorsk, Oleksandrivka, and Orikhiv directions.
Reports regarding the counteroffensive actions of Ukrainian Defense Forces in southern Ukraine began emerging in mid-February. These were corroborated by military correspondents and analysts, including Kostiantyn Mashovets from the Information Resistance group and the American Institute for the Study of War. On February 17, General Oleksandr Syrskyi, the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, confirmed these reports, highlighting successful counterattacks and assaults around Huliaipole.
